You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@directory.apache.org by er...@apache.org on 2006/04/27 04:08:50 UTC

svn commit: r397361 - in /directory/trunks/apacheds/osgi/main: apacheds.sh log4j.properties pom.xml src/main/java/ src/main/manifest/ src/main/resources/log4j.properties

Author: erodriguez
Date: Wed Apr 26 19:08:48 2006
New Revision: 397361

URL: http://svn.apache.org/viewcvs?rev=397361&view=rev
Log:
Updated the ApacheDS OSGi Main:
o  log4j.properties moved to resources and copied to conf.
o  Main class removed in favor of reusable Felix Main.

Added:
    directory/trunks/apacheds/osgi/main/src/main/resources/log4j.properties
      - copied, changed from r396997, directory/trunks/apacheds/osgi/main/log4j.properties
Removed:
    directory/trunks/apacheds/osgi/main/log4j.properties
    directory/trunks/apacheds/osgi/main/src/main/java/
    directory/trunks/apacheds/osgi/main/src/main/manifest/
Modified:
    directory/trunks/apacheds/osgi/main/apacheds.sh
    directory/trunks/apacheds/osgi/main/pom.xml

Modified: directory/trunks/apacheds/osgi/main/apacheds.sh
URL: http://svn.apache.org/viewcvs/directory/trunks/apacheds/osgi/main/apacheds.sh?rev=397361&r1=397360&r2=397361&view=diff
==============================================================================
--- directory/trunks/apacheds/osgi/main/apacheds.sh (original)
+++ directory/trunks/apacheds/osgi/main/apacheds.sh Wed Apr 26 19:08:48 2006
@@ -6,4 +6,4 @@
   mvn clean install
 fi
 
-java -Dlog4j.configuration=file://$(pwd)/log4j.properties -jar bin/felix.jar
+java -Dlog4j.configuration=file://$(pwd)/conf/log4j.properties -jar bin/felix.jar

Modified: directory/trunks/apacheds/osgi/main/pom.xml
URL: http://svn.apache.org/viewcvs/directory/trunks/apacheds/osgi/main/pom.xml?rev=397361&r1=397360&r2=397361&view=diff
==============================================================================
--- directory/trunks/apacheds/osgi/main/pom.xml (original)
+++ directory/trunks/apacheds/osgi/main/pom.xml Wed Apr 26 19:08:48 2006
@@ -9,29 +9,11 @@
   <artifactId>apacheds-osgi-main</artifactId>
   <name>ApacheDS OSGi Server Main</name>
   <packaging>jar</packaging>
-  <dependencies>
-    <dependency>
-      <groupId>org.apache.felix</groupId>
-      <artifactId>org.apache.felix.framework</artifactId>
-      <version>0.8.0-SNAPSHOT</version>
-    </dependency>
-  </dependencies>
-  <properties>
-    <property name="install.home" value="${basedir.absolutePath}"/>
-  </properties>
   <build>
     <plugins>
       <plugin>
         <groupId>org.apache.maven.plugins</groupId>
-      	<artifactId>maven-jar-plugin</artifactId>
-      	<configuration>
-      	  <archive>
-      	    <manifestFile>src/main/manifest/Manifest.mf</manifestFile>
-      	    <manifest>
-      	      <mainClass>org.apache.directory.server.Main</mainClass>
-      	    </manifest>
-      	  </archive>
-      	</configuration>
+        <artifactId>maven-jar-plugin</artifactId>
       </plugin>
       <plugin>
         <artifactId>maven-antrun-plugin</artifactId>
@@ -48,8 +30,8 @@
                 <mkdir dir="${basedir}/conf"/>
                 <delete dir="${basedir}/bundle"/>
                 <mkdir dir="${basedir}/bundle"/>
-                <copy file="${basedir}/target/apacheds-osgi-main-${pom.version}.jar" tofile="${basedir}/bin/felix.jar"/>
                 <copy file="${basedir}/target/classes/config.properties" todir="${basedir}/conf"/>
+                <copy file="${basedir}/target/classes/log4j.properties" todir="${basedir}/conf"/>
               </tasks>
             </configuration>
             <goals>
@@ -72,11 +54,18 @@
                 <artifactItems>
                   <artifactItem>
                      <groupId>org.apache.felix</groupId>
+                     <artifactId>org.apache.felix.main</artifactId>
+                     <version>0.8.0-SNAPSHOT</version>
+                     <type>jar</type>
+                     <outputDirectory>${basedir}/bin</outputDirectory>
+                     <destFileName>felix.jar</destFileName>
+                  </artifactItem>
+                  <artifactItem>
+                     <groupId>org.apache.felix</groupId>
                      <artifactId>org.apache.felix.framework</artifactId>
                      <version>0.8.0-SNAPSHOT</version>
                      <type>jar</type>
                      <outputDirectory>${basedir}/lib</outputDirectory>
-                     <!--<destFileName>optional-new-name.jar</destFileName>-->
                   </artifactItem>
                   <artifactItem>
                      <groupId>org.apache.felix</groupId>

Copied: directory/trunks/apacheds/osgi/main/src/main/resources/log4j.properties (from r396997, directory/trunks/apacheds/osgi/main/log4j.properties)
URL: http://svn.apache.org/viewcvs/directory/trunks/apacheds/osgi/main/src/main/resources/log4j.properties?p2=directory/trunks/apacheds/osgi/main/src/main/resources/log4j.properties&p1=directory/trunks/apacheds/osgi/main/log4j.properties&r1=396997&r2=397361&rev=397361&view=diff
==============================================================================
    (empty)